Seminar paper from the year 2007 in the subject American Studies - Comparative Literature, grade: 1,0, Technical University of Braunschweig, language: English, comment: A close reading on both texts. , abstract: In order to work out similarities in the lines of thought expressed in the screenplay to the movie "THX 1138" by George Lucas and Don DeLillo's novel "White Noise", the author performs a close reading of both texts. While the plots of both works are completely different, this paper aims to show that the thoughts, beliefs and fears of 'cold-war-America' expressed in both works - death, echnology, capitalism versus communism, and the impact of media on society and the individual - can be found in both texts.
